Buying Guide for Straight Shaft to Tapered Shaft Adapter
Understanding the Purpose of the Adapter
When I first looked for a straight shaft to tapered shaft adapter, I realized it’s essential for connecting two shafts with different profiles. This adapter allows me to fit a straight shaft component onto a tapered shaft or vice versa, ensuring smooth power transmission and alignment in mechanical systems.
Identifying the Shaft Sizes and Tapers
One of the first things I checked was the exact diameter of both the straight shaft and the tapered shaft. Measuring these accurately is crucial because the adapter must match both ends perfectly to avoid issues like slipping or misalignment. I also paid attention to the taper angle, as different machines might have varying taper specifications.
Material and Build Quality
I always look for adapters made from durable materials such as hardened steel or alloy. Since these adapters endure rotational forces and sometimes harsh conditions, a high-quality build ensures longevity and reliable performance. I also considered corrosion resistance depending on my working environment.
Compatibility with My Equipment
Before purchasing, I made sure the adapter was compatible with the specific equipment I use. This involved checking manufacturer specifications or consulting technical drawings. Compatibility is key to avoiding damage to either shaft or adapter.
Ease of Installation
I appreciated adapters that come with clear instructions and are designed for straightforward installation. Some adapters require precise alignment or additional tools, so I factored in how easy it would be to fit the adapter without professional help.
Load and Torque Capacity
Understanding the load and torque the adapter can handle was important for me. I needed to ensure the adapter could withstand the operational stresses of my machinery to prevent failure during use.
Cost vs. Value
While shopping, I balanced cost against the quality and specifications of the adapter. Sometimes a higher upfront cost was justified by better durability and performance, saving me money and downtime in the long run.
Final Thoughts
Choosing the right straight shaft to tapered shaft adapter requires careful measurement, attention to material quality, and compatibility checks. Taking the time to assess these factors helped me find an adapter that fit well and performed reliably in my applications.
